Presented is a stunningly elegant hand painted porcelain bowl made by Meissen. The large bowl is a wonderful white color with a wide, raised leaf border. The raised leaf patterns are carefully outlined in gilding to beautiful effect. The center of the bowl is carefully hand painted with a lovely cluster of purple and yellow flowers.
The bowl is marked in blue on the underside with the blue crossed swords mark for the Meissen mark used between 1924-1934. There are two cancel marks across it.
The condition is excellent. The bowl rings beautifully. The original gilding is in great shape, with only a little wear here and there. The central painting is in fabulous condition. There are very few utensil marks to the bowl, and I suspect it was rarely used. The side of the bowl also has a small brown dimple which is under the glaze. This is visible in the second to last photo. As you can see, it is very small and, because of the bowl's shape, will never be noticed when the bowl is set on the dinner table. There are no chips, no cracks, no crazing, no breaks, and no repairs.
The bowl measures approximately 12 inches in diameter and 2 inches tall.
The bowl weighs 2 pounds, 2 ounces.
